About the memorial: A white marble tablet, set in a mottled marble frame with columnar sides and corbels, showing dedication in black, uppercase, incised lettering. At the bottom of the tablet is the badge of the Coldstream Guards. It is associated with the elaborate central panel on the reredos showing two saints and two angels. It is in the St Michael's Chapel

In Memory/of/ Richard Charles Graves-Sawle Esq/ Only Son of/ Rear Admiral Sir Charles John/ Graves-Sawle Bart RN MVO/ And Lady Graves-Sawle and/ Husband of Muriel Graves Sawle/ Lieutenant of the Coldstream / Regiment of foot guards. Killed/ in action at Ypres, Belgium/ on the 2nd Day of November 1914/ Aged 26 Years./ "UNTIL THE DAY BREAK AND/ THE SHADOWS FLEE AWAY."/ THIS TABLET AND THE CENTRE PANEL/ OF THE REREDOS ARE ERECTED BY/ THE TENANTRY OF THE PENRICE/ LANESCOT AND BARLEY ESTATES.
